嘿,朋友们!今天咱们来聊聊一个超级酷炫的话题——如何用智能合约来优化以太坊钱包里的代币交易。如果你对区块链和加密货币感兴趣,那这篇文章绝对会让你眼前一亮。
首先,我们得明白啥是以太坊钱包和智能合约。简单来说,以太坊钱包就是你在区块链世界里的‘银行账户’,它能帮你存储各种代币(比如ETH、ERC-20代币等等)。而智能合约呢?你可以把它想象成一个自动执行的程序,只要你设定好规则,它就会按照你的要求运行,不需要任何中介插手。
那么问题来了,为什么我们需要用智能合约来优化代币交易呢?答案很简单:效率、安全性和成本控制。传统的代币交易方式可能会遇到很多麻烦,比如高昂的手续费、复杂的步骤或者潜在的安全隐患。而智能合约就像一位贴心的小助手,能够帮你搞定这些问题。
举个例子吧。假设你有一个以太坊钱包,里面存了一些ERC-20代币,你想把这些代币分发给你的朋友们。如果没有智能合约的帮助,你就得一个个手动发送,还得支付每次交易的Gas费用(这是以太坊网络上进行交易时需要支付的一种费用)。如果朋友比较多,这个过程不仅耗时还费钱。
但有了智能合约就不一样了!你可以编写一段代码,告诉智能合约要怎么分发这些代币。比如说,‘把这100个代币平均分配给以下10个地址’。然后只要部署一次智能合约,所有的事情都会自动完成。这样一来,不仅节省了时间,还大大降低了Gas费用,因为你只需要为部署智能合约支付一次费用,而不是多次单独交易。
当然,智能合约的好处远不止于此。比如在代币交换场景中,传统的交易所可能需要你先将代币转入平台,然后再进行交易。这个过程中,你的资产实际上处于第三方的掌控之下,存在一定的风险。而通过智能合约实现的去中心化交易所(DEX),可以直接在链上完成点对点的交易,完全不需要信任任何中间方。这种方式不仅更安全,还能避免因为平台跑路或被黑而导致的资金损失。
再来说说安全性。智能合约一旦部署到区块链上,就几乎不可能被篡改。这意味着只要你编写代码的时候足够小心,确保没有漏洞,那么后续的交易就会非常可靠。而且现在很多项目还会找专业的审计团队对智能合约进行审查,进一步提高其安全性。
不过,虽然智能合约有这么多优点,但也不是完全没有挑战。编写智能合约需要一定的技术门槛,尤其是对于那些不熟悉编程的人来说。此外,如果智能合约中存在漏洞,也可能被黑客利用,造成严重的后果。所以,在使用智能合约之前,一定要做好充分的研究和测试。
总的来说,利用智能合约优化以太坊钱包中的代币交易是一个非常值得尝试的方向。无论是提高效率、降低成本还是增强安全性,智能合约都能为你带来实实在在的好处。希望这篇文章能给你一些启发,也欢迎大家在评论区分享自己的看法和经验哦!
最后提醒一下,区块链技术日新月异,学习永无止境。如果你想在这个领域有所建树,那就赶紧行动起来吧!加油!